    Quote Originally Posted by Salt Flat View Post
    I see a lot of the mounts had a thumbscrew added to take out any slop.
    According to Herbert McBride, the common solution for those shooters on the front lines in WWI worried about loss of zero or inability to shoot accurately with the set-up "as issued" was to use broken off strips of "safety razor" blades inserted between the scope and mount. Then rusted in place on purpose to really lock things together.

    Not saying that's what you ought to do, but if you ever find yourself in the trenches...
